Aliste, a region in the province of Zamora, Spain, offers diverse landscapes for outdoor activities. It is partially encompassed by the Arribes del Duero Natural Park, characterized by dramatic canyons carved by the Duero River and impressive granite cliffs. The region also features the Esla River and sections of the Sierra de la Culebra, providing varied terrain for several sports like hiking, mountain biking, road cycling, touring cycling, and more.

Aliste features the dramatic canyons of the Arribes del Duero Natural Park, carved by the Duero River, with granite cliffs up to 1,300 feet (400 meters) high. The Esla River and its Quintos Bridge are notable, as is the Pozo de los Humos waterfall on the Uces River, which drops over 160 feet (50 meters).

Aliste, particularly within the Arribes del Duero Natural Park and Sierra de la Culebra, is home to diverse wildlife. Species include the golden eagle, griffon vulture, black stork, and the Iberian wolf. The unique microclimate supports a rich biodiversity.
The region features charming traditional villages like Santa Cruz de los Cuérragos, Robledo, Ungilde, and Riomanzanas, often showcasing slate architecture. Alcañices, the capital of the Aliste comarca, retains remnants of its ancient wall and historical churches. The Mozarabic Way, a Jacobean route, also passes through the region.
The highest point mentioned in the broader area is Peña Mira, located in the Sierra de la Culebra. It reaches an elevation of 4,070 feet (1,241 meters), offering extensive views of the surrounding landscape.
